HTML5文字加边框项目方案

项目背景

在现代Web开发中,提升用户体验与页面美观性是至关重要的。而文字作为信息传递的主要载体,其样式设计也显得尤为重要。为了提高文字的可读性与吸引力,给文字添加边框是一种常见的设计方法。本方案将详细介绍如何使用HTML5与CSS来给文字添加边框,并通过相关示例进行演示。

项目目标

  1. 实现文字边框效果的展示。
  2. 提高页面的视觉吸引力。
  3. 增强用户的阅读体验。

项目实施步骤

1. 技术准备

本项目将使用HTML和CSS。HTML用于结构的创建,CSS用于样式的设计。我们将利用CSS的边框属性来实现文字边框效果。

2. 环境搭建

首先,我们需要创建一个基本的HTML文件,以下是结构示例:

<!DOCTYPE html>
<html lang="zh">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>文字边框示例</title>
    <link rel="stylesheet" href="styles.css">
</head>
<body>
    这是一个带边框的标题
    <p class="bordered-text">这是一个带边框的段落。通过给文字添加边框,可以使其更加突出。</p>
</body>
</html>

3. CSS样式设计

接下来,我们为文字设置边框的CSS样式。在styles.css文件中,我们可以添加以下代码:

.bordered-text {
    border: 2px solid #3498db; /* 边框颜色和宽度 */
    padding: 10px; /* 内边距使文字不紧贴边框 */
    border-radius: 5px; /* 圆角边框 */
    font-size: 20px; /* 字体大小 */
    color: #333; /* 字体颜色 */
    background-color: #ecf0f1; /* 背景颜色 */
    display: inline-block; /* 使元素仅包围内容 */
    margin: 10px 0; /* 上下外边距 */
}

4. 效果展示

在完成上述步骤后,打开HTML文件,你会看到带有边框的文字效果。这样的设计使得文字从背景中凸显出来,显得更加引人注目。

交互流程

以下是用户与页面交互的序列图,展示了用户如何查看和与带边框文字的界面互动:

sequenceDiagram
    participant User as 用户
    participant Browser as 浏览器
    participant Server as 服务器
    User->>Browser: 打开网页
    Browser->>Server: 请求HTML文档
    Server-->>Browser: 返回HTML文档与CSS样式
    Browser-->>User: 渲染带边框的文字
    User->>Browser: 点击边框文字
    Browser-->>User: 显示文字的更多信息

用户旅程

用户旅程图展示了用户在项目中的整体体验,从他们输入URL开始,到与带边框文字的交互。这有助于我们理解用户在使用过程中的感受与反馈。

journey
    title 用户与带边框文字的不一样旅程
    section 进入页面
      用户访问网站: 5: 用户
      浏览器加载文字和样式: 4: 浏览器
    section 交互体验
      用户查看带边框文字: 5: 用户
      用户点击文字进行更多了解: 4: 用户
      系统返回详细信息: 5: 系统

项目总结

通过本项目,我们展示了如何在HTML5中使用CSS为文字添加边框。清晰简洁的边框设计可以有效地提升网页的视觉效果,增强内容的可读性和吸引力。希望通过这一方案,能够为Web设计师在文字样式的设计方面提供一定的参考与启发。

在后续的工作中,我们可以继续探索边框样式创新、响应式设计等领域,为用户提供更为丰富的视觉体验和功能。同时,建议在项目完成后,进行用户测试,以获取更多的反馈,进一步优化设计。

感谢您的阅读,期待为您提供更优质的Web设计方案!